Analysis

In 2024, current health expenditure per capita in New Zealand stood at 5,022 current US$.

That represents a change of up 0.5% on the previous year and up 25.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, current health expenditure per capita in New Zealand peaked at 5,138 current US$ in 2022 and was at its lowest, 1,054 current US$, in 2001.

New Zealand ranks 20th of 193 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 25 years of available data.

Current health expenditure per capita in New Zealand, year by year

Annual values for Current health expenditure per capita (current US$) in New Zealand, 2000 to 2024.
Year current US$ Change
2000 1,054 current US$
2001 1,054 current US$ -0.1%
2002 1,250 current US$ +18.6%
2003 1,611 current US$ +28.8%
2004 1,982 current US$ +23.0%
2005 2,295 current US$ +15.8%
2006 2,304 current US$ +0.4%
2007 2,706 current US$ +17.4%
2008 2,709 current US$ +0.1%
2009 2,582 current US$ -4.7%
2010 3,073 current US$ +19.0%
2011 3,501 current US$ +13.9%
2012 3,683 current US$ +5.2%
2013 3,834 current US$ +4.1%
2014 3,997 current US$ +4.3%
2015 3,434 current US$ -14.1%
2016 3,517 current US$ +2.4%
2017 3,702 current US$ +5.3%
2018 3,707 current US$ +0.1%
2019 3,680 current US$ -0.7%
2020 3,888 current US$ +5.7%
2021 4,749 current US$ +22.2%
2022 5,138 current US$ +8.2%
2023 4,997 current US$ -2.7%
2024 5,022 current US$ +0.5%
